FDA Regulations in the U.S.

If your market is the United States, your journey goes through the U.S. Food and Drug Administration (FDA). The FDA regulates all medical devices sold within the country, with its Center for Devices and Radiological Health (CDRH) taking the lead. This branch is responsible for overseeing every firm that manufactures or imports these products for sale in the U.S. Think of them as the essential gatekeepers for the American market. Meeting their standards is non-negotiable, so understanding their requirements from the start is a critical first step.

The EU’s Medical Device Regulation (MDR)

Planning to sell in Europe? Then you’ll need to get familiar with the EU’s Medical Device Regulation (MDR). This framework is the European Union’s answer to ensuring device safety and performance. The EU Medical Device Regulation establishes comprehensive requirements covering clinical evaluation, technical documentation, and post-market surveillance. Compliance is mandatory for gaining market access across all EU member states, making the MDR a key hurdle to clear for any company with European ambitions.

Important International Standards

Beyond individual country regulations, global standards create a common language for quality. The most important of these is ISO 13485, an international standard for medical device quality management systems. The FDA has even moved to align its own quality system rules with ISO 13485, signaling its global importance. Adopting this standard helps you build a robust quality system that is recognized worldwide. This streamlines compliance across different regions and demonstrates a serious commitment to safety and quality—a major asset when approaching any regulatory body.

The Push for Global Harmonization

While you’ll always have to meet specific regional requirements—like those from the FDA or the EU—there’s a growing movement to align these rules. This push for global harmonization aims to make the regulatory process more consistent across borders. Organizations like the World Health Organization (WHO) play a big part by providing technical guidance to help standardize expectations for device safety and performance. This collaborative effort helps reduce redundant testing and paperwork, making it easier for innovative devices to reach patients around the world.

Implement a Quality Management System

A Quality Management System (QMS) isn’t just a binder of rules that sits on a shelf; it’s the operational backbone of your company’s commitment to safety and quality. The FDA’s Quality Management System Regulation (QMSR) is now harmonized with the global standard, ISO 13485. This means implementing a robust QMS is non-negotiable for ensuring your device meets current good manufacturing practices (CGMP). A well-implemented QMS helps you consistently produce safe, effective devices and provides a clear framework for all your processes, from design to post-market activities. It’s your playbook for maintaining compliance and building a culture of quality within your team. You can find a helpful overview of device regulation directly from the FDA.

Your Guide to Essential Regulatory Pathways

Getting your medical device to market feels like following a map, and the FDA has several different routes you can take. These are called regulatory pathways, and choosing the right one is one of the most important decisions you’ll make. The path you take depends entirely on your product: its level of risk, its intended use, and whether anything like it already exists. Picking the wrong one can lead to significant delays and costs, so it’s crucial to get it right from the start.

Think of it this way: a simple, low-risk device won’t need the same intense scrutiny as a life-sustaining implant. The FDA has created a system that matches the level of review to the potential risk, ensuring public safety without stifling innovation. We’ll walk through the four most common pathways: the 510(k) Premarket Notification, the Premarket Approval (PMA), the De Novo Classification request, and the Emergency Use Authorization (EUA). Understanding the basics of each will help you form a clear regulatory strategy and set realistic expectations for your product’s journey to approval.

510(k) Premarket Notification

The 510(k) pathway is the most common route for medical devices in the U.S. It’s designed for devices that are considered low to moderate risk (Class I and II). The core of a 510(k) submission is demonstrating that your new device is “substantially equivalent” to a product that is already legally on the market, known as a “predicate device.” This doesn’t mean your device has to be identical, but it must have the same intended use and similar technological characteristics. Because you’re proving similarity rather than starting from scratch, this pathway is generally faster and less data-intensive than a full Premarket Approval. The FDA provides a detailed overview of device regulation that covers this process.

Premarket Approval (PMA)

If your device is high-risk (Class III) or supports or sustains human life, you’ll likely need to go through the Premarket Approval (PMA) process. This is the most rigorous pathway the FDA has. Unlike a 510(k), a PMA requires you to provide valid scientific evidence proving your device is safe and effective for its intended use. This usually involves extensive laboratory, animal, and clinical trial data. The goal isn’t to show your device is similar to another one, but to prove its safety and effectiveness on its own merits. Because of the high stakes and comprehensive data requirements, the PMA process is significantly more time-consuming and costly than other pathways, reflecting the critical nature of global regulatory authorities in protecting public health.

De Novo Classification

What if your device is new and innovative, but still low to moderate risk? If there’s no predicate device on the market to compare it to for a 510(k), the De Novo pathway might be your answer. This route is specifically for novel products that don’t fit into existing categories. Instead of proving substantial equivalence, you provide evidence that the device’s benefits outweigh its risks and that existing controls can ensure its safety and effectiveness. A successful De Novo request results in the FDA creating a brand-new classification for your device, which can then serve as a predicate for future products. It’s a streamlined medical device approval process for first-of-their-kind technologies.

Emergency Use Authorization (EUA)

The Emergency Use Authorization (EUA) pathway is a unique and temporary option that the FDA can use during a declared public health emergency, like a pandemic. An EUA allows for the rapid deployment of unapproved medical products—or unapproved uses of approved products—when there are no adequate, approved, and available alternatives. The goal is to get critical medical countermeasures to patients and healthcare providers as quickly as possible. It’s important to remember that an EUA is not the same as a full FDA approval or clearance. It’s a temporary authorization that lasts only for the duration of the emergency, providing a vital mechanism for crisis response in the regulation of medical devices.

Regulating AI and Machine Learning

The integration of artificial intelligence (AI) and machine learning (ML) into medical devices presents a unique regulatory puzzle. Unlike traditional software, some AI/ML systems can learn and change after they’re on the market. This ability to evolve based on new data is powerful, but it challenges a regulatory system built around reviewing a finished product. To address this, the FDA is actively developing a new framework for AI/ML-based software. This approach aims to allow for safe and controlled modifications post-market, ensuring the device remains effective without requiring a full re-submission for every algorithm update.

A Focus on Cybersecurity

As more medical devices connect to the internet, hospital networks, and other devices, cybersecurity has become a top priority for regulators. A security breach could compromise sensitive patient data or, even worse, affect a device’s functionality and put patients at risk. Because of this, robust cybersecurity is now considered a fundamental part of device safety. The FDA has issued extensive cybersecurity guidance that outlines expectations for manufacturers throughout a product’s entire lifecycle, from design and development to post-market monitoring. Proving your device is secure is no longer optional; it’s a critical piece of the approval process.

Preparing for Emerging Technologies

Regulatory agencies recognize that rapid innovation requires flexible and forward-thinking oversight. The goal is to foster groundbreaking advancements without compromising patient safety. To achieve this balance, agencies are creating adaptive regulatory pathways that can accommodate new and complex technologies. Programs like the FDA’s Breakthrough Devices Program are designed to give patients more timely access to novel devices by expediting their development, assessment, and review. This proactive stance helps ensure that the regulatory process supports, rather than hinders, the next generation of medical technology, making it easier for truly innovative products to reach the people who need them.
